This is the first time I post a message here. I have a 164 in Vancouver. Having a 164 in vancouver is not easy because you have to pass an emmision test every year in order to get it registerd and get insurance. I did not pass. In fact their CO meter went wild. It'll cost me at least $400cdn to get a mechanic to fix it. I have been deeling with old Volvos back in Sweden since I was 15 but I think I am in over my head in this one. Especially since I don't have a co meter handy. I have checked all the obvious parts like plugs, air filter and switches. The engin runs perfect. The ideling is eaven at 700 rpm. The fuel consuption is high at a little over 2 liters per 10 km. (What is normal for the B30 with carburators??) But otherwise there is nothing wrong with the behaivour of the engin. Does anyone have advice or sugestions how to cut the emissions without spending $400cdn and compromising the nice engin preformance? They check for NOx and CO so these have to balanced, I guess??
